The instant revision petition is filed under Section 397 read with Section 401 of the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973 (hereinafter “Cr.P.C.”) seeking setting aside of the Order dated 13th March, 2020 and Order dated 25th August, 2022 qua the petitioner passed by the learned Additional Sessions Judge, South East District, New Delhi (hereinafter “ASJ”). 2. The brief facts of the case are that the petitioner along with other co- accused entered the house of the prosecutrix and allegedly physically assaulted the prosecutrix and her family members. It is also alleged that the Signature Not Verified Digitally Signed By:PRAVEEN KUMAR BABBAR CRL.REV.P. 186/2023 Page 1 of 11 Signing Date:06.02.2025 18:34:21 petitioner misbehaved with the prosecutrix and took away valuable articles from her house. 3. Accordingly, the instant FIR dated 7th May, 2016 was registered against the petitioner and other co-accused, and vide Order dated 13th March, 2020, the learned ASJ held that a prima facie case is made out against the petitioner under Sections 376D/323/354/427/452/395/509/149 of the Indian Penal Code, 1860 (hereinafter “IPC”). 4.
